Analysis

Guadeloupe recorded 0 terawatt-hours for annual change in primary energy use in 2024.

Over the whole period, annual change in primary energy use in Guadeloupe peaked at 1.31 terawatt-hours in 2000 and was at its lowest, -10.21 terawatt-hours, in 2012.

Guadeloupe ranks 158th of 218 regions on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
